Running your intake into your cab is very noisy I don't suggest it. If you don't like the look a snorkel you could always run your intake up into the cowl like I did.
I modified my air filter box and ran some 3" RV sewer line through the firewall and now it takes air from beside the wiper motor. No noise and I know I can be in water up to the bottom of my windshield (Not that I would ever do that) but it's not pulling from behind my headlight anymore.
